GK Sunbreaker Systems
The GK system is an architectural aluminum solution designed to control solar heat gain while adding a modern aesthetic touch to building facades.
Key Technical Specifications:
- Profile Varieties: Features various blade sizes including 100 mm and 120 mm elliptical (wing-shaped) profiles.
- Weight: Varies by profile size (e.g., the 100 mm profile weighs approximately 0.968 kg/m).
- Structural Properties: High moment of inertia values (e.g., $J_x: 31.08\ cm^4$ for specific profiles) ensure stability against wind loads.
- Material: Produced from high-grade AA 6063 aluminum alloy.
